    Melzombie said:
    need hotel recommendations in a safe area, not too expensive.. please.... the flights from my airport to St. Louis are shitty and expensive for some reason. I guess less demand.  
    no, STL is not really a hub for many of the major airlines anymore. we knocked out a bunch of local municipalities to build a new runway back in the mid 90s. we were supposed to become a major hub for a few airlines. then 9/11 happened and lambert did not get to be a hub. it is frustrating flying in and out of here because we do not have as many direct flights as we used to have before 9/11.

    Melzombie said:
    I'm coming from South Carolina. What is St. Louis known for? any interesting history? I would like to visit the arch!
    there is too much to see here in the day or two you will be in town.

    known for beer, the AB brewery is downtown. known for sports, the cardinals will be in town that weekend. known for food, great BBQ and italian food. the zoo and forest park are top notch.
